#7d4c5d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7d4c5d is composed of 49% red, 29.8% green and 36.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 39.2% magenta, 25.6%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 339.2 degrees, a saturation of 24.4% and a lightness of 39.4%. #7d4c5d color hex could be obtained by blending #fa98ba with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#7d4c5d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030202 is the darkest color, while #f9f6f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7d4c5d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#666364 is the less saturated color, while #c30648 is the most saturated one.
